What the HCI SHRL Certification actually is

The Human Capital Institute's Strategic HR Leadership (SHRL) Certification is a live, instructor-led virtual training delivered over a single 2-day intensive — full days via Zoom, with multiple cohort dates scheduled throughout the year. Enrollment is open with no stated prerequisites; it's positioned for HR practitioners looking to move from tactical execution into strategic people leadership. To earn the certification, participants attend all sessions, complete classwork, and pass a multiple-choice exam with a score of 80% or higher.

HCI publishes its price directly: $1,995 for individual enrollment, with a 20% discount for HCI Premium or Corporate members. The certification carries recertification credit across several bodies — 13.5 HCI credits, 13.5 HRCI credits, 13.5 SHRM credits, and 12 ATD credits — and HCI's own certifications must be renewed every 3 years by earning 60+ HCI credits in that period.

What People Leader Accelerator actually is

PLA is a 16-week cohort-based program (Spring: January–May; Fall: August–November) capped at 15 mid-career HR leaders per cohort, built specifically for people operating inside investor-backed, growth-stage organizations. Instead of testing what you know, the program is structured around applying core frameworks — including how the company actually makes money, diagnosis-first HR, and goal-setting tied to business outcomes — directly to your own org, in real time, with live faculty and 1:1 coaching included. Alumni keep lifetime access to the PLA community after the cohort ends.
